Final Thoughts on License Plate Registration Colorado
The license plate registration process in Colorado provides a straightforward and efficient way to obtain and manage vehicle registrations, with key takeaways including the requirement for annual registration, the need for proof of insurance and vehicle emissions inspections in certain counties, and the various registration fee structures in place. The Colorado Department of Motor Vehicles oversees this process, ensuring compliance with state regulations.
